SCHEDULE: Howard Lutnick Completes Divestiture of Cantor Equity Shares

Sentiment:

Schedule 13D Amendment


Howard W. Lutnick has completed the divestiture of his holdings in Cantor Equity Partners IV, Inc. due to his appointment as U.S. Secretary of Commerce, ceasing to be a beneficial owner.

Summary

  • Howard W. Lutnick has completed the previously announced divestiture of his holdings in Cantor and CFGM.
  • This divestiture was undertaken in connection with his appointment as the U.S. Secretary of Commerce.
  • The sale of his interests was finalized on October 6, 2025.
  • As a result, Mr. Lutnick no longer possesses any voting or dispositive power over the securities of Cantor Equity Partners IV, Inc.
  • He has ceased to be a Reporting Person and, as of October 6, 2025, no longer beneficially owns any Ordinary Shares.
  • Mr. Lutnick ceased to be a beneficial owner of more than 5% of the outstanding Ordinary Shares.
